Output 52c8d9399ea56fa2143c96a99c98eb6b78799db889a8a7f67413dc38b1f8d88d:3

value
1098666
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0636c49228ef8ede89201fc8ab713ab843ed8856 OP_EQUAL
address
32Fsb2ozxGzQqEeJXksLsLPG4vSPR42E2Q
transaction
52c8d9399ea56fa2143c96a99c98eb6b78799db889a8a7f67413dc38b1f8d88d
spent
true